Local Lenders: The Tangible Advantage of Community Expertise

Local lenders in Memphis bring a depth of market-specific insight that online platforms often can’t match. Their intimate understanding of regional economic factors, neighborhood trends, and local credit environments allows them to tailor mortgage products and rates more precisely. Moreover, face-to-face consultations facilitate trust and nuanced discussions about loan options, including FHA and conventional loans. Borrowers often find value in personalized underwriting flexibility and quicker turnaround times for Memphis-specific loan programs.

Online Mortgage Platforms: Harnessing Technology for Competitive Rates

Conversely, online mortgage lenders leverage technology to streamline the application and approval process, often offering competitive mortgage rates due to reduced overhead costs. Their platforms provide fast rate comparisons, instant pre-approvals, and extensive loan options accessible from anywhere. However, this convenience may come at the cost of less personalized service and potential challenges navigating complex loan scenarios or local market idiosyncrasies.

Decoding Memphis Mortgage Rate Volatility: Advanced Economic Indicators and Their Impact

While many borrowers focus on headline mortgage rates, truly expert homebuyers delve into the economic undercurrents that drive Memphis mortgage rate fluctuations. Key indicators such as the 10-year Treasury yield, inflation expectations, and regional employment data hold significant sway over mortgage pricing models. For instance, a rising 10-year Treasury yield generally signals upward pressure on fixed mortgage rates, as lenders demand higher yields for long-term loans. Memphis’s local economic health, including its manufacturing output and tourism sector growth, also subtly shifts lending risk assessments, influencing the margin lenders add over benchmark rates.

Understanding these macroeconomic and microeconomic factors allows Memphis buyers to anticipate rate movements and strategically time their mortgage lock-ins. The U.S. Treasury Department’s daily yield curve rates provide an authoritative resource for monitoring these critical trends.

What Advanced Credit Profile Factors Influence Memphis Mortgage Rates Beyond the Standard FICO Score?

Beyond the traditional FICO score, lenders increasingly incorporate alternative data points that can affect your Memphis mortgage rate. These include debt-to-income ratio nuances, credit utilization patterns over time, and even rental payment history when verified through third-party services. Some local lenders may also weigh employment stability in sectors predominant in Memphis, such as logistics and healthcare, offering borrowers in these fields preferential rates due to perceived job security.

Moreover, the rise of automated underwriting systems enables lenders to process complex credit profiles with greater granularity, sometimes uncovering hidden credit strengths that traditional scoring overlooks. Borrowers equipped with this knowledge can proactively present comprehensive financial documentation to local lenders, potentially unlocking more favorable mortgage terms.

Expert Insight: Negotiation Tactics to Lower Your Memphis Mortgage Interest Rate

Even in competitive markets, mortgage rates are not entirely fixed. Experienced Memphis borrowers leverage negotiation strategies such as presenting competing lender quotes, requesting lender credits to offset closing costs, or opting for slightly higher points to secure lower rates. Local lenders, valuing community relationships, may be more amenable to these negotiations, especially when borrowers demonstrate strong creditworthiness and preparedness.

Additionally, understanding lender-specific pricing adjustments—for example, those applied for certain loan-to-value ratios or occupancy types—can empower you to structure your loan application to achieve better rates. Engaging a knowledgeable mortgage broker familiar with Memphis lenders can provide a strategic advantage in this nuanced negotiation landscape.

How Can Memphis Homebuyers Effectively Time Mortgage Rate Locks Amid Rapid Market Changes?

Mortgage rate locking is a sophisticated tactic that can safeguard borrowers against rising costs but requires precise timing to avoid missed opportunities. Memphis buyers should monitor both national rate trends and local market signals, including housing inventory levels and seasonal demand fluctuations. Utilizing rate lock extension options or float-down clauses, increasingly offered by local lenders, can provide additional flexibility in uncertain markets.

Consulting with mortgage professionals who track daily rate movements and understand Memphis’s economic cycles enables more informed decisions about when to lock and for how long. Tools from the Freddie Mac Mortgage Rate Outlook offer predictive models that can complement local expertise.
